Advertisement

H3C华三SSH配置登录设置开启

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:DOCX


简介:
本教程详细介绍了如何在H3C华三设备上启用和配置SSH登录设置,包括必要的步骤、命令及安全建议。 ### H3C网络设备SSH配置详解 #### 一、引言 SSH(Secure Shell)是一种加密的网络传输协议,常用于远程登录管理网络设备。对于H3C(华三)网络设备而言,SSH提供了安全的方式来管理和配置设备。本段落将详细介绍如何在H3C设备上启用并配置SSH服务。 #### 二、配置SSH服务的关键步骤 根据提供的描述和部分配置内容,我们可以总结出以下关键步骤: ##### 1. 进入系统视图 ``` system-view ``` 这条命令用于进入系统视图,是进行任何高级配置的基础。 ##### 2. 生成公钥 ``` [Switch] public-key local create rsa ``` 在系统视图下输入以上命令来创建RSA类型的公钥。需要注意的是,公钥的大小可以在512到2048位之间选择,较大的公钥会提供更高的安全性,但生成时间也会更长。 提示: - 如果选择的公钥大小超过512位,默认情况下为1024位,可能会花费几分钟的时间来生成。 - 通过按`CTRL+C`键可以中断公钥的生成过程。 示例: ``` Input the bits of the modulus [default = 1024]: ``` 这里可以选择输入自定义的公钥位数,如果不输入则默认为1024位。 ##### 3. 启用SSH服务 ``` [Switch] ssh server enable ``` 这条命令用于启用SSH服务,使得设备能够接受来自SSH客户端的连接请求。 ##### 4. 配置VLAN接口的IP地址 为了使SSH客户端能够连接到设备,我们需要配置一个可用的IP地址。例如: ``` [Switch] interface vlan-interface 1 [Switch-Vlan-interface1] ip address 192.168.1.40 255.255.255.0 ``` ##### 5. 设置用户界面的认证模式 为了让SSH客户端能够成功登录,需要设置用户界面的认证模式。例如: ``` [Switch] user-interface vty 0 4 [Switch-ui-vty0-4] authentication-mode scheme ``` 这一步骤指定了认证模式为scheme,即使用AAA认证方式进行身份验证。 ##### 6. 配置SSH客户端登录协议 继续在用户界面视图下配置SSH协议作为登录方式: ``` [Switch-ui-vty0-4] protocol inbound ssh ``` ##### 7. 创建本地用户并设置权限 为了允许SSH客户端登录,还需要创建一个本地用户,并指定相应的密码和服务类型。例如: ``` [Switch] local-user client001 [Switch-luser-client001] password simple aabbcc [Switch-luser-client001] service-type ssh [Switch-luser-client001] authorization-attribute level 3 ``` 额外配置: 还可以为SSH用户配置其他服务类型和认证方式,例如: ``` [Switch] ssh user client001 service-type stelnet authentication-type password ``` 这一步骤是可选的,用于配置SSH用户`client001`的服务类型为telnet,并指定认证方式为密码认证。 #### 三、总结 通过以上步骤,我们已经完成了H3C设备上的SSH配置,包括生成公钥、启用SSH服务、配置VLAN接口、设置认证模式以及创建本地用户等关键操作。这些步骤确保了可以通过SSH协议安全地远程登录和管理网络设备。 #### 四、扩展阅读 - **公钥算法选择**:除了RSA外,还可以选择DSA等其他类型的公钥算法,具体选择可以根据实际需求和安全性考虑来决定。 - **认证方式多样化**:除了密码认证外,还可以采用公钥认证等方式提高安全性。 - **SSH版本升级**:随着技术的发展,SSH版本也在不断更新,升级到最新的SSH版本可以获得更好的性能和更强大的功能。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• H3CSSH
    优质
    本教程详细介绍了如何在H3C华三设备上启用和配置SSH登录设置,包括必要的步骤、命令及安全建议。 ### H3C网络设备SSH配置详解 #### 一、引言 SSH(Secure Shell)是一种加密的网络传输协议,常用于远程登录管理网络设备。对于H3C(华三)网络设备而言,SSH提供了安全的方式来管理和配置设备。本段落将详细介绍如何在H3C设备上启用并配置SSH服务。 #### 二、配置SSH服务的关键步骤 根据提供的描述和部分配置内容,我们可以总结出以下关键步骤: ##### 1. 进入系统视图 ``` system-view ``` 这条命令用于进入系统视图,是进行任何高级配置的基础。 ##### 2. 生成公钥 ``` [Switch] public-key local create rsa ``` 在系统视图下输入以上命令来创建RSA类型的公钥。需要注意的是,公钥的大小可以在512到2048位之间选择,较大的公钥会提供更高的安全性,但生成时间也会更长。 提示: - 如果选择的公钥大小超过512位,默认情况下为1024位,可能会花费几分钟的时间来生成。 - 通过按`CTRL+C`键可以中断公钥的生成过程。 示例: ``` Input the bits of the modulus [default = 1024]: ``` 这里可以选择输入自定义的公钥位数,如果不输入则默认为1024位。 ##### 3. 启用SSH服务 ``` [Switch] ssh server enable ``` 这条命令用于启用SSH服务,使得设备能够接受来自SSH客户端的连接请求。 ##### 4. 配置VLAN接口的IP地址 为了使SSH客户端能够连接到设备,我们需要配置一个可用的IP地址。例如: ``` [Switch] interface vlan-interface 1 [Switch-Vlan-interface1] ip address 192.168.1.40 255.255.255.0 ``` ##### 5. 设置用户界面的认证模式 为了让SSH客户端能够成功登录,需要设置用户界面的认证模式。例如: ``` [Switch] user-interface vty 0 4 [Switch-ui-vty0-4] authentication-mode scheme ``` 这一步骤指定了认证模式为scheme,即使用AAA认证方式进行身份验证。 ##### 6. 配置SSH客户端登录协议 继续在用户界面视图下配置SSH协议作为登录方式: ``` [Switch-ui-vty0-4] protocol inbound ssh ``` ##### 7. 创建本地用户并设置权限 为了允许SSH客户端登录,还需要创建一个本地用户,并指定相应的密码和服务类型。例如: ``` [Switch] local-user client001 [Switch-luser-client001] password simple aabbcc [Switch-luser-client001] service-type ssh [Switch-luser-client001] authorization-attribute level 3 ``` 额外配置: 还可以为SSH用户配置其他服务类型和认证方式,例如: ``` [Switch] ssh user client001 service-type stelnet authentication-type password ``` 这一步骤是可选的,用于配置SSH用户`client001`的服务类型为telnet,并指定认证方式为密码认证。 #### 三、总结 通过以上步骤,我们已经完成了H3C设备上的SSH配置,包括生成公钥、启用SSH服务、配置VLAN接口、设置认证模式以及创建本地用户等关键操作。这些步骤确保了可以通过SSH协议安全地远程登录和管理网络设备。 #### 四、扩展阅读 - **公钥算法选择**:除了RSA外,还可以选择DSA等其他类型的公钥算法,具体选择可以根据实际需求和安全性考虑来决定。 - **认证方式多样化**:除了密码认证外,还可以采用公钥认证等方式提高安全性。 - **SSH版本升级**:随着技术的发展,SSH版本也在不断更新,升级到最新的SSH版本可以获得更好的性能和更强大的功能。
  • SSH远程
    优质
    本教程详细介绍了如何在华三网络设备上配置SSH远程登录功能,包括必要的软件安装、基础配置步骤和安全注意事项。 华三设备SSH配置及开启SSH远程登录的相关命令。
  • H3C Pvlan
    优质
    本教程详细介绍如何在H3C华三网络设备上配置Pvlan(私有_VLAN),涵盖概念解析、配置步骤及应用场景,适合网络管理员学习参考。 华三 H3C Pvlan 设置 可以实现无需使用VLAN就能达到隔离的效果。
  • Linux SSH免密
    优质
    本指南详细介绍了如何在Linux系统中配置SSH免密登录,通过生成和交换公钥来实现安全便捷的远程访问。 配置Linux SSH免密码登录的方法是:首先生成密钥对;然后需要在哪个主机上实现免密码SSH登录就在该主机的`authorized_keys`文件中进行相应的设置。例如,如果要对名为hadoop00的机器执行此操作,并且使用的用户名为root,则按照这种方式进行配置。
  • LinuxSSH免密
    优质
    简介:本教程详细介绍如何在Linux系统中配置SSH免密登录,提高远程操作的安全性和便捷性。通过使用公钥认证,实现无需输入密码即可访问目标主机的目的。 Linux配置SSH免密码登录调试文档对配置Hadoop有帮助。
  • Git BashSSHLinux的方法
    优质
    本文介绍了如何在Git Bash中配置SSH以实现安全地登录到Linux系统。通过设置SSH密钥,可以避免频繁输入密码,简化开发流程并增强安全性。 今天分享如何在Git Bash中配置SSH登录Linux的方法,这具有很好的参考价值,希望能对大家有所帮助。一起看看吧。
  • GitSSH免密指南.doc
    优质
    本文档提供了详细的步骤和说明,指导用户如何为Git配置SSH免密登录,以实现更高效、安全的代码仓库访问。 git配置ssh免密登录 文档内容主要介绍如何通过SSH方式实现Git的免密码登录,提高开发效率及安全性。步骤包括生成SSH密钥对、添加公钥到Git服务器以及在本地机器上配置相应的SSH文件等操作细节。详细的操作过程和注意事项会在文中具体说明。
  • Linux远程SSH免密
    优质
    简介:本文将指导读者如何在Linux系统中配置远程SSH免密登录,提高操作便捷性和安全性。通过详细步骤实现无密码访问另一台机器。 在Linux系统中,SSH(Secure Shell)是一种网络协议,用于安全地远程登录到另一台计算机,并执行命令、传输文件等操作。配置SSH无密码登录可以极大地简化运维工作,提高效率,同时减少手动输入密码带来的安全风险。以下是基于CentOS 6.8系统的详细步骤来配置远程SSH的无密码登录: 1. **创建公钥和私钥**: 使用`ssh-keygen`命令生成RSA类型的公钥和私钥对。运行以下命令: ``` [root@test ~]# ssh-keygen -t rsa Generating publicprivate rsa key pair. Enter file in which to save the key (root.sshid_rsa): <按回车键接受默认位置> Enter passphrase (empty for no passphrase): <直接按回车,不设置密码> Enter same passphrase again: <再次按回车> ``` 这将创建两个文件:`id_rsa`(私钥)和`id_rsa.pub`(公钥),存储在用户的`.ssh`目录下。 2. **拷贝公钥到远程主机**: 使用`ssh-copy-id`命令将本地主机的公钥复制到远程主机的`~/.ssh/authorized_keys`文件中,以允许无密码登录。例如: ``` [root@test ~]# ssh-copy-id -i ~/.ssh/id_rsa.pub root@192.168.0.178 ``` 首次连接时,系统可能会提示确认远程主机的RSA指纹,输入`yes`继续,并且需要提供远程主机root用户的密码。成功后,公钥会被添加到远程主机的`authorized_keys`文件中。 3. **测试远程连接**: 现在应该可以无密码登录到远程主机了。尝试使用以下命令进行验证: ``` [root@test ~]# ssh root@192.168.0.178 ``` 如果配置正确,此时不应再需要输入密码。 为了确保安全性,请遵循如下最佳实践: - 不要将SSH服务的默认端口(通常为22)暴露在公共互联网上。可以通过修改`/etc/ssh/sshd_config`文件中的`Port`选项来更改端口号。 - 定期更换私钥,避免长时间使用同一组密钥。 - 对`.ssh`目录和其中的文件设置适当的权限:通常是700(对于目录)和644(对于文件)。 - 考虑仅通过密钥对而非密码进行身份验证,因为这种方式提供了更强的安全性。 以上步骤完成后,您已经成功配置了Linux系统的SSH无密码登录。这使得在多台服务器之间管理时可以更高效且安全地执行远程操作。务必谨慎处理公钥和私钥以防止未经授权的访问。
  • Linux远程SSH免密
    优质
    本教程详细介绍如何在Linux系统中配置远程SSH免密登录,提高用户访问服务器的安全性和便捷性。 本段落实例为大家分享了在Linux系统下配置远程SSH无密码登录的方法,具体内容如下: 系统:CentOS 6.8 主机1:192.168.0.177 主机2:192.168.0.178 工具介绍: - ssh-keygen:用于创建公钥和私钥。 - ssh-copy-id:将生成的公钥复制到目标机器(如本例中的192.168.0.178)上的authorized_keys文件中,并设置相关目录权限。 ### 1)创建公钥和密钥 在主机上执行以下命令: ``` [root@test ~]# ssh-keygen -t rsa ```
  • SSHKey实现免密详解
    优质
    本文详细讲解了如何通过配置SSH Key来实现免密登录,帮助用户提高远程操作效率和安全性。适合初学者参考学习。 生成的key与一对用户绑定:一个是生成key的本地用户,另一个是存储这个公钥的远端主机上的特定用户。SSH的工作原理就是将公钥提供给他人,自己保留私钥;因此,远端主机上的其他用户无法看到指定用户的公钥信息。这就确保了每个用户之间的通信是一对一的。